INGREDIENTS (for 8 servings):
- 1 recipe pastry for a 9 inch double crust pie
- 3/4 cup white sugar
- 3 tablespoons cornstarch
- 1 (20 ounce) can crushed pineapple with juice
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ice
- 2 tablespoons milk
- 1 tablespoon white sugar
PREPARATION:
Preheat oven to 425 degrees F (220 degrees C).
In a medium saucepan combine sugar, cornstarch, pineapple with juice, and lemon juice. Cook over medium heat, stirring constantly until thickened, then allow to boil 1 minute.
Cool slightly and pour mixture into pastry-lined pie pan. Cover with top crust and seal. Make a few steam vents in crust, then brush with milk and sprinkle with sugar. Place in preheated oven and bake for 35 minutes. Serve chilled or at room temperature.
